My computer keeps defaulting to me being on mute, resulting in others not being able to hear me during video calls (on both doxy.me and simple practice video)
When I do telehealth sessions on my computer, I can hear the other person, but they can't hear me. This happens across two different video platforms. In my computer settings, I clicked on "sound settings" and "troubleshoot"- results were "it looks like your device is mute, would you like to unmute it?" I clicked on "yes".
However, when I start a video session thereafter, the person I am talking to still can't hear me. I've tried turning my computer off and on too, done the troubleshooting several times and this is across several video sessions at different times. Would appreciate any advice!! (this is Windows 10 on a Lenovo). Why does my computer keep reverting to being on mute? (others can't hear me- but I still have sound on the computer for videos) |
